Skip to content

New landing page#525

Merged
angelina-ji merged 4 commits into
masterfrom
new-landing-page
Apr 30, 2026
Merged

New landing page#525
angelina-ji merged 4 commits into
masterfrom
new-landing-page

Commits

Commits on Apr 15, 2026

Commits on Apr 30, 2026